Neonatal Seizures: New Evidence, Classification, and Guidelines.
Julie Ziobro1, Betsy Pilon2, Courtney J Wusthoff3,4
1Division of Pediatric Neurology, Department of Pediatrics, University of Michigan, Ann Arbor, MI, USA.
Neonatal seizures are common in newborns due to unique physiology and delivery risks. Recent advances offer improved diagnosis, classification, and treatment guidelines for better patient outcomes.
